金橙G螯合树脂分离富集样品中铂,铑的研究张辉1,唐杰1(1.河北省唐山市唐山师范学院化学系)摘 要:合成了金橙G螯合树脂,并用于分离富集样品中的铂,铑.实验研究表明,分离富集试液酸度为pH 1.0,分离柱高为200 mm,通过分离柱的试液流速为0.4 mL/min时,加入铂,铑标准物质的回收率在94.5%~103%之间.标准样品经金橙G螯合树脂分离富集后,采用极谱法连续测定铂,铑,测定结果与标准值相吻合.关键词:金橙G螯合树脂; 分离富集; 铂; 铑......
铑Ⅲ-水溶性苯胺蓝-溴酸钾体系阻抑动力学光度法测定痕量铑宋学省1(1.山东省临沂市山东临沂师范学院实验中心)摘 要:在磷酸介质中痕量铑Ⅲ对KBrO3氧化水溶性苯胺蓝褪色反应有很强的抑制作用,据此建立了阻抑动力学光度法测定痕量铑Ⅲ的新方法.在选定条件下,方法的线性范围是0.4~0.8 ng/mL,检出限为2.73×10-11 g/mL,表观活化能为167.26 kJ/mol.试验了30多种共存离子的影响,大多数的常见离子不干扰.方法用于两个催化剂样品中铑的测定,相对标准偏差(RSD)分别为2.0%和2.3%,加标......
